Community Care Assistant Location:

Nottingham, Gedling (NG4) Pay:

11.60 per hour ( 12.30 per hour for weekend shifts) Travel Pay:

45p Per Mile, 16p Per Minute of Travel Time Hours: Morning Shift: 7:00am - 2:00pm Evening Shift: 4:00pm - 9:00pm Flexibility to work either one shift or both (split shifts) is available. You will be expected to work 1 weekend out of every 2. Contract Type:

Long-term to Permanent About the Role: We are looking for a compassionate and dedicated

Community Care Assistant

to provide high-quality care and support to individuals in their own homes. You will help service users maintain their independence and dignity while assisting with personal care, medication, meals, and social activities. Your role will also involve supporting their physical and emotional well-being, ensuring comfort, safety, and quality of life. Key Responsibilities: Assist with personal care tasks such as showering, dressing, and mobility support. Administer medication according to individual care plans. Prepare meals and accommodate dietary needs. Support clients with social and physical activities to promote independence. Monitor clients' health and report any concerns promptly. Maintain clear and effective communication with clients, their families, and healthcare professionals. Requirements: A Driving Licence & access to a vehicle is essential. A passion for helping others and improving their quality of life. Flexibility to work the shifts outlined above, including one weekend out of two. Previous experience in care or a similar role is beneficial but not essential. Willingness to participate in mandatory training when required. Must be able to work independently and as part of a team. What We Offer: Paid training and opportunities for career development. A downloadable App where all care calls are visible.
